Admin Friend! I appreciate your effort to help me, but I found the solution.
![]() With a hint of companion Alexander Zeid, i made the followings change: Replace the Following: Query Port: 1717 With: Query Port: 7778 Again, thank you for your help! (Subject Resolved!!!) Att.: Nic0o0o |
